Puran Poli
A sweet flatbread made from wheat flour and stuffed with a mixture of jaggery and split yellow gram, best enjoyed with ghee. You can find excellent Puran Poli at local festivals and street vendors.

Sabudana Khichdi
A savory dish made from tapioca pearls, peanuts, and spices, typically consumed during fasting. Visit the street food stalls near temples for the best experience.
Vada Pav
A popular street food consisting of a spicy mashed potato filling encased in a chickpea batter, served in a bun. A must-try at Bhaji Vada's stall in the busy market area.

Tipping & Payment
Ensure a smooth experience
Tipping
In Bāgor, as in many parts of India, tipping is generally appreciated but not mandatory. It is common to leave small tips for service providers such as restaurant staff, taxi drivers, and hotel personnel. Typically, a tip of 10% of the bill is considered courteous, especially in more upscale settings. However, in smaller establishments, rounding up the bill or leaving spare change is often satisfactory.
Payment
Payment practices in Bāgor reflect a blend of traditional and modern methods. Cash transactions remain prevalent, particularly in local markets and small shops. However, digital payments are gaining popularity, especially following the COVID-19 pandemic, with many vendors accepting mobile wallets and apps like UPI (Unified Payments Interface). Credit and debit cards are also accepted in larger establishments, but carrying cash is advisable for smaller purchases.
Best Time to Visit
And what to expect in different seasons...
Winter (November to February)
The best time to visit Bāgor, with pleasant temperatures ranging from 10°C to 26°C. Ideal for outdoor activities and exploring the scenic surroundings.
Spring (March to April)
A mild season with temperatures between 20°C to 30°C. It's a great time for sightseeing and experiencing local festivals.
Summer (May to June)
Hot and dry, with temperatures soaring up to 40°C. It is advisable to stay hydrated and seek cooler indoor attractions during the peak heat of the day.
Monsoon (July to October)
Characterized by heavy rainfall, the landscape turns lush and green. While the region's beauty is enhanced, travel may be affected due to weather conditions.
